Output 2504e2fa476a0bd3504925981e856b8c7b5c68dc36cbebcd830bd327652a150f:1

value
1004582
script pubkey
OP_0 OP_PUSHBYTES_32 70e5d55bdc6fa8de740ae1a77723e4d53c04fdb16a7fbf87efa5f35a970a9ef7
address
bc1qwrja2k7ud75duaq2uxnhwgly657qfld3dflmlpl05he449c2nmmse06ju9
transaction
2504e2fa476a0bd3504925981e856b8c7b5c68dc36cbebcd830bd327652a150f
confirmations
109453
spent
true